India, England players observe minute's silence, wear black armbands
Posted
In a poignant tribute, the India and England cricket teams honored the 274 victims of the Ahmedabad air disaster with a minute's silence and black armbands at Headingley. The tragic crash, claiming the lives of Indian and British citizens, deeply affected both teams as they commenced their five-Test series.
